What companies run services between St. Louis, MO, USA and Plitvice Lakes National Park, Croatia?

There is no direct connection from St. Louis to Plitvice Lakes National Park. However, you can take the train to LAMBERT AIRPORT TERMINAL #1 station, walk to Lambert–St. Louis International Airport (STL) airport, fly to Zagreb Franjo Tuđman Airport (ZAG), walk to Stari terminal, take the line 290 bus to Zračna luka, walk to Velika Gorica, Zagreb Airport, take the shuttle to Zagreb, walk to Zagreb, Autobusni Kolodvor, take the bus to Plitvička Jezera, D1, then walk to Plitvička Jezera. Alternatively, you can take the train to LAMBERT AIRPORT TERMINAL #1 station, walk to Lambert–St. Louis International Airport (STL) airport, fly to Zadar Airport (ZAD), walk to Zadar Airport, take the bus to Zadar, Autobusni Kolodvor, take the bus to Plitvička Jezera, aut.kolodvor, then walk to Plitvička Jezera, aut.kolodvor.
